溫馨提示×

c語言如何累乘

小億
87
2024-10-11 16:59:13
欄目: 編程語言

在C語言中,要實現累乘可以通過循環(huán)語句(如for循環(huán))來實現。

以下是一個簡單的示例代碼,演示了如何使用for循環(huán)實現兩個數的累乘:

#include <stdio.h>

int main() {
    int num1 = 2;
    int num2 = 3;
    int result = 1;

    for (int i = 1; i <= num2; i++) {
        result *= num1;
    }

    printf("The product of %d and %d is %d\n", num1, num2, result);

    return 0;
}

在上面的代碼中,我們定義了兩個整數變量num1和num2,并將它們的值分別初始化為2和3。我們還定義了一個名為result的整數變量,并將其初始化為1。

接下來,我們使用for循環(huán)來實現累乘操作。在每次循環(huán)中,我們將result的值乘以num1的值,并將結果存儲回result變量中。循環(huán)將一直執(zhí)行num2次,因此我們將得到num1和num2的乘積。

最后,我們使用printf函數輸出結果。在這個例子中,輸出的結果是“The product of 2 and 3 is 6”。

你可以根據需要修改num1和num2的值來實現不同數的累乘操作。

0